Home and Gardens nearby 46 Amwell Street, London EC1R 1XS, United Kingdom



Green & Fay

Approximately 1.45 km away
Address: 137-139 Essex Rd, London N1 2NR, United Kingdom

Oliver Bonas

Approximately 1.46 km away
Address: 3, 6 Great New St, London EC4A 3BF, United Kingdom

Don & Dorian Limited

Approximately 1.47 km away
Address: 14, 47 Provost St, London N1 7NZ, United Kingdom

Aston Matthews

Approximately 1.47 km away
Address: 141-147 Essex Rd, London N1 2SN, United Kingdom

Handyman Plus London

Approximately 1.48 km away
Address: Kemp House, 152-160 City Rd, London EC1V 2NX, United Kingdom

Bath Sorts Ltd

Approximately 1.52 km away
Address: 38 Offord Rd, London N1 1DL, United Kingdom

The Tile Box

Approximately 1.53 km away
Address: 40 Offord Rd, London, Islington N1 1EB, United Kingdom

Camera City

Approximately 1.58 km away
Address: 16 Little Russell St, London WC1A 2HL, United Kingdom

Upper Street DIY

Approximately 1.6 km away
Address: 204 Upper St, London N1 1RQ, United Kingdom

The Bowery

Approximately 1.71 km away
Address: 36-38 New Oxford St, London WC1A 1EP, United Kingdom

Just Add Water

Approximately 1.81 km away
Address: 202-228 York Way, London N7 9AZ, United Kingdom

Snappy Snaps

Approximately 1.84 km away
Address: 245 Upper St, London, Highbury N1 1RU, United Kingdom

Lombok

Approximately 1.91 km away
Address: 204-208 Tottenham Court Rd, London W1T 7PL, United Kingdom

Dwell

Approximately 1.92 km away
Address: 200 Tottenham Court Rd, London W1T 7PL, United Kingdom

Raft

Approximately 1.93 km away
Address: 184 Tottenham Court Rd, London W1T 7PF, United Kingdom